Course Details

Introduction to Electric Aircraft Aerodynamics: Fundamentals of aerodynamics, electric aircraft components, and the impact of electric propulsion on aerodynamic design.
Basic Aerodynamics Principles: Airfoil design, lift, drag, and thrust, and the role of aerodynamics in aircraft performance.
Electric Propulsion Systems: Types of electric motors, power electronics, and energy storage systems for electric aircraft.
Aircraft Aerodynamics and Electric Propulsion Integration: Interactions between aerodynamics and electric propulsion, including thrust vectoring, motor cooling, and energy management.
Design Considerations for Electric Aircraft: Noise reduction, weight reduction, and aerodynamic optimization for electric aircraft.
Regulations and Standards for Electric Aircraft: Current and future regulations and standards for electric aircraft certification and operation.
Advanced Electric Aircraft Aerodynamics: Advanced topics such as boundary layer ingestion, distributed propulsion, and morphing wings.
Electric Aircraft Aerodynamics Analysis and Simulation: Numerical methods and software tools for analyzing and simulating electric aircraft aerodynamics.
Emerging Technologies in Electric Aircraft Aerodynamics: Latest research and development in electric aircraft aerodynamics, including new materials, manufacturing techniques, and control systems.
